2016-08-06 131 views
0

我在tomcat中将WAR项目部署为SI项目。我遵循链接中描述的步骤: http://forum.spring.io/forum/spring-projects/integration/101509-best-way-to-deploy-spring-integration-projects-into-a-container-war-ejb在WAR部署期间包含SI项目的依赖关系

我的SI项目由JMS适配器组成,用于接收消息并将消息发布到MQ。我在我的SI项目中将pom.xml中包含的Websphere MQ jar作为依赖关系。

在我的Spring MVC项目中,我将我的SI项目添加为依赖项。但是,我不得不再次将MQ Jars包含在Spring MVC项目的pom.xml中。

当我将SI项目添加为依赖项时,是否有可能将我的SI项目所需的所有jar包含在我的Spring MVC项目中?

回答

0

只要SI项目没有为其(例如MQ)依赖关系指定providedoptional,Maven就应该将它的依赖关系传递到战争中。